This variegated Alocasia stands out with striking patterns of white, cream, and light green against its dark green foliage. Each leaf develops its own unique variegation, making every plant one of a kind and adding an extra touch of tropical interest to any collection.
Plant in full to part sun. Water every week until established. Pruning is not necessary but aged leaves can be cut at the base. Apply a slow release fertilizer in early spring. Keep a layer of mulch around the base of the plant year-round to conserve water and reduce weeds.
